Output 8c19ba43644952bfbbbcfb5cf5dfd2bf47f0b2c7265e58739b39765a4cd4d6b2:5

value
2608245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373e782ff5f4f968e7999eea85955acbd71ed OP_EQUAL
address
3BMEX5aDpMPFdorDfETAAfCw9nNaqooMXi
transaction
8c19ba43644952bfbbbcfb5cf5dfd2bf47f0b2c7265e58739b39765a4cd4d6b2
confirmations
402397
spent
true